Margaret Hayes Nelson, 85, died at the White Oak Nursing Center on Tuesday, Jan. 4, 2011.

Born in Lincoln, Neb., she was the daughter of Frank and Edith Hayes. She and her husband, Paul, lived in Kansas, Michigan and Florida before moving to Tryon in 2003. She was a graduate of the University of Nebraska and holds a graduate degree from Michigan State University. She was a middle school teacher, retiring from the Adrian, Mich., school system in 1985. She was a 25-year member of the Punta Gorda, Fla., womens club, serving as its president in 1993. She was also active in many other organizations throughout her working and retirement years. She was a member of the Congregational Church in Tryon. She and Paul were married for 64 years.

In addition to her husband, she is survived by two sons, Bruce Nelson (Teri) and Mark Nelson (Sandy), and a daughter, Janet Mapes (Douglas). She is also survived by a sister, Marilyn Ellerbeck (Lloyd), seven grandchildren and two great-grandchildren.
